Diethyl Sebacate (CAS 110-40-7) is a chemical compound that has found significant utility across various industrial sectors due to its advantageous chemical and physical properties. As a diester of sebacic acid, it exhibits characteristics that make it an ideal choice for applications ranging from agrochemical synthesis to polymer modification. Understanding these properties is crucial for procurement managers and R&D scientists looking to leverage its potential.

Chemically, Diethyl Sebacate has the molecular formula C14H26O4 and a molecular weight of approximately 258.35 g/mol. Its IUPAC name is diethyl decanedioate. Physically, it is typically described as a colorless to light yellow liquid. Key physical properties include a boiling point of around 312 °C and a melting point of 1-2 °C, indicating it remains liquid under most standard operating temperatures. Its flash point is above 230 °F, signifying a relatively low flammability risk, and it is generally insoluble in water but soluble in many organic solvents. These attributes are critical for its use as a solvent and in synthesis reactions where it needs to remain stable and miscible.

One of the most prominent uses of Diethyl Sebacate is as an agrochemical intermediate. Its structure provides a versatile building block for the synthesis of various pesticides and other crop protection agents. The purity levels, typically 99% or higher, are essential for ensuring the efficacy and safety of these agricultural chemicals. Farmers and agrochemical companies rely on the consistent quality of intermediates like Diethyl Sebacate to produce effective solutions for crop management. Another significant application is its role as a plasticizer and softener. Diethyl Sebacate can be incorporated into polymers, resins, and rubbers to enhance their flexibility, reduce brittleness, and improve low-temperature performance. This makes it valuable in the manufacturing of plastics, films, and coatings where material resilience is a key performance indicator.
